The RSC Associate Schools Playmaking Festival is a celebration of the talent and voices of young people. Each night, over a hundred students from across the East of England will collaborate to perform an abridged version of one of Shakespeare’s most beloved plays.
The festival marks the debut of the RSC Associate Schools programme in the region and will showcase the partnership and work of 14 primary, secondary, and special schools led by Ormiston Sudbury Academy, one of only 25 RSC Lead Associate Schools in the country.
